The 9th Ward Field of Dreams seeks to build a state-of-the art athletic facility, including a football field and Olympic-sized running track, on the campus of G.W. Carver High School for the Arts in New Orleans in an effort to increase graduation rates and prevent crime and drug use.
The Africa Foundation facilitates the empowerment and development of people living in or adjacent to protected areas in Africa, by forging unique partnerships between conservation initiatives and communities.
ARK is an international charity that focuses on transforming children’s lives. Employing over 1,000 staff directly and through partners, ARK’s programs are highly focused on meeting pre-defined strategic goals in the areas of health (Sub-Saharan Africa), education (UK, India) and child protection (Eastern Europe).
Amaudo UK is a British charity working in partnership with Nigeria-based Amaudo Itumbauzo to achieve its goal of implementing accessible, affordable and sustainable systems of mental health care in South-Eastern Nigeria and providing rehabilitation for those who have become homeless due to mental health problems or learning disabilities.
Big Apple Greeters provides a free public service that helps visitors discover New York City’s ethnically and culturally diverse neighborhoods through the eyes of its residents.
British Red Cross (BRC) is a volunteer-led humanitarian organization that helps vulnerable people at home and overseas prepare for and respond to emergencies in their own communities.
The Brotherhood Crusade is dedicated to building and sustaining an institution that raises funds and resources from within the community and distributes those funds directly back into the community so that community members may grow and prosper.
Ibstone School strives to provide every child with the very best educational opportunities to help them reach their full potential.
The Global Heritage Fund’s mission is to save the Earth’s most significant and endangered cultural heritage sites in developing countries and regions through scientific excellence and community development.
Helen & Douglas House provides respite and end-of-life care for children and young adults with life-shortening conditions, as well as support and friendship for the entire family.
Moving Mountains is a charity based in Ireland that is committed to relieving poverty for children in developing countries.
SeeSaw helps children and their families both before and after a major bereavement, helping them to move forward and to face the future with hope.
Service Six offers a range of free and confidential information, services, counseling and support to young people in Northamptonshire, England, in order to help them cope with issues such as abuse, bullying and sexual health.
Shannon Trust runs the Toe-by-Toe Reading Plan, an award-winning peer mentoring program that encourages and supports prisoners who can read to give one-to-one tutoring to prisoners who struggle with reading.
The Sierra Leone War Trust for Children promotes the education, health, rehabilitation and self-sufficiency of disadvantaged children and youth in Sierra Leone through advocacy and financial and technical support.
The Laurie Engel Fund works with the Teenage Cancer Trust and the Birmingham Children’s Hospital to raise the funds needed to design and build a state-of-the-art hospital ward for teenagers with cancer.
The Thames Valley Air Ambulance provides a life-saving service to relieve sickness and injury seven days a week, 365 days a year, covering Berkshire, Oxfordshire and Buckinghamshire.
Project Walk provides improved quality of life for people with spinal cord injuries through intense, exercise-based recovery programs, education, support and encouragement.
The William J. Clinton Foundation launched the Clinton Climate Initiative (CCI) to create and advance solutions to the core issues driving climate change. They take a holistic approach, addressing the major sources of greenhouse gas emissions and the people, policies, and practices that impact them.
